Tshuaj Cov Lus
| Ib feem | Wt. % |
| C | Max 0.1 |
| Zaum fe | Max 0.5 |
| H | Max 0.015 |
| N | Max 0.05 |
| O | Max 0.4 |
| Ti | 99 |
Cov Ntawv Thov
Airfram Cheebtsam, cov hlab ntsha cryogenic, kev hloov cua sov, CPI khoom siv, condenser tubing, pickling pob tawb.
